Probation officers manage cases based on court orders and department guidelines. The specific individuals assigned to an officer’s caseload are generally not public information due to privacy regulations. However, the process of learning about monitoring is typically formal, not speculative. Individuals usually receive written notices outlining their conditions, including any monitoring requirements such as electronic home confinement or drug testing. To inquire officially, a person on probation may submit a request through their caseworker or the court clerk’s office. In some jurisdictions, general program information is available via government websites without revealing personal identifiers. It is important to distinguish between learning about the system and attempting to identify specific individuals, which often has strict boundaries.

Common Questions About Monitoring Procedures

What Information Is Publicly Available About Probationers?

Most personal details, including name and specific monitoring status, are protected by privacy laws. Aggregate data on program participation may be published for statistical purposes.

Can I Request Details About My Own Case?

Yes, individuals under supervision have the right to review their probation file. This is usually done by contacting the supervising officer or the court office handling the case. Official channels are the only reliable method.

Are There Online Directories for Probationers?

Public online directories that list individuals on probation or parole are extremely rare and often illegal. Relying on such sites can lead to misinformation or legal complications.

How Do Electronic Monitoring Devices Work?

These devices use radio frequency or GPS to confirm a person’s location. Alerts are sent to the probation office if boundaries are violated. The technology supports supervision rather than replacing human interaction.

What Should I Do If I Have Questions About Supervision Rules?

Direct communication with a probation officer is the best approach. They can clarify conditions, expectations, and the available resources for compliance.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A major misunderstanding is that the general public can easily access lists of monitored individuals. In reality, such information is confidential and protected. Another myth is that electronic monitoring is a form of punishment rather than a tool for accountability and safety. Some believe that probation officers have unlimited surveillance powers, whereas their authority is clearly defined by statute and court order. There is also confusion about the role of technology; it assists monitoring but does not eliminate the need for in-person meetings and human judgment.
